What they do

A Teacher Assistant assists classroom teachers by providing extra individual attention and instruction to students. Helps teachers with recordkeeping, preparation for lessons and activities and supervising students. May work with special education students, or work in a school library or computer lab; may be called teacher aide or paraprofessional.

Job Description

Substitute teachers are responsible for leading small classes of approximately 20 students in classrooms. A college degree and a substitute license is required. Reimbursement for the sub license is available. Regular teachers provide substitute teaching plans. There is need at elementary, middle, and secondary levels. Substitute Para-professionals support instruction in the classrooms by working with groups and individuals. A degree is not required, but any post-secondary education it is preferred. All positions require a resume, references, interview, and background check. Work hours are approximately 8am-3:15 or 4:15pm. Substitutes are also provided a school lunch for full-days. We are a small school environment with approximately 10 students per grade level and 2 grade levels per room (multi-age). It is personal, connected, and you work closely with other supporting adults as each room has multiple adults staffed in it. The jobs are on-call, however, often a one or more day notice is provided for planned absences. Occasionally arrangements need to be made between 7-8am on the same day. This is done directly via phone/text.
